In 1840, Edmond Bailey entered the world in Independence, Oakland County, Michigan, born to William Bailey And Clarissa M Shotwell. In 1863, Edmond Bailey resided in Oak, Michigan, United States. Edmond Bailey married Laura B Anderson, and had children including Aden Bailey, Alexander Bailey, Anna L Bailey, Byron E B Bailey, Charles E Bailey, Clarissa Jane Woods, Ethel Bailey, Ethel E Bailey, Floyd Bailey, Fred D Bailey, James V Corbett Bailey, Laurence Bailey, Lillian Bailey, Mary Elizabeth Bailey, Mattie M Brooks, Ordelia Delia Bailey, Pearl Stockwell. Edmond Bailey passed away in 1912 in Harrison, Clare County, Michigan, United States of America.
